Kinds Of Car Keys
Before diving into the programming aspect, it is important to understand the different kinds of car keys currently in use. This will help distinguish the programming methods needed for each type.
Standard Keys: These are one of the most standard form of car keys. They have no electronic components and can usually be cut by a locksmith with the correct key code.
Transponder Keys: These keys contain a chip that communicates with the car's ignition system. If the chip is not recognized, the car won't start. Programming involves integrating the chip with the car's Computer Control Unit (CCU).
Remote Key Fobs: These keys integrate traditional key functions with remote locking and unlocking capabilities. They generally have built-in transponders, requiring similar programming as transponder keys.
Smart Keys: Also referred to as keyless entry systems, clever keys don't require physical insertion into the ignition. They utilize a wireless system to unlock and start the vehicle when the key is in close proximity.
Keyless Ignition Keys: These keys function like wise keys but specifically focus on beginning the vehicle without traditional ignition techniques.
The complexity of programming these keys differs, often making it challenging for car owners to manage the process separately.
The Key Programming Process
Programming a car key in Milton Keynes typically includes the following actions:
Step 1: Obtain the Correct Key
To program a brand-new key, you initially need to make sure that you have the correct key type for your vehicle. Keys can vary greatly in between makers and models, and the wrong key will not program to your car.
Action 2: Access the Vehicle's Onboard Diagnostics (OBD) Port
A lot of contemporary vehicles have an OBD-II port, typically situated under the control panel. This port allows the key programming tool to access the vehicle's computer to Program Car Keys Milton Keynes brand-new keys.
Step 3: Use a Key Programmer Tool
Expert locksmiths or car dealerships utilize specialized key programming tools. These devices connect to your car's OBD-II port and permit users to input commands to include brand-new keys.
Step 4: Follow the Programming Instructions
The key programming tool will normally provide on-screen guidelines tailored to the make and model of the Vehicle Locksmith Milton Keynes. Here's a basic overview that may be associated with the programming procedure:
Turn the ignition to the ON position.Connect the key developer to the OBD-II port.Select the vehicle design on the developer.Follow the triggers to program a brand-new key.Check the freshly configured key to ensure performance.Step 5: Verify the New Key
After programming, test the new key to make sure that it can start the vehicle and carry out remote locking/unlocking functions (if relevant).
Common Issues Encountered
Although programming car keys may appear uncomplicated, numerous problems can occur, consisting of:
Incorrect Key Type: Using the incorrect key can result in failure in programming.Faulty Key Fob: Sometimes, the key fob itself might be faulty.Battery Issues: Low battery in the key fob can prevent it from communicating with the vehicle.Software application Issues: Occasionally, problems within the vehicle's software may avoid successful programming.When to Seek Professional Help
